Renascence publishes scholarship on literature, with a particular focus on religious and theological themes. Articles analyze literary works across various periods and genres, exploring concepts such as faith, conversion, mysticism, and redemption. The journal also examines the intersection of literature with history, politics, and cultural anxieties, including colonialism and trauma.
